Overview

What is Store To Door?

Store To Door is a private, nonprofit organization established in 1989, situated in Portland, Oregon. Their primary purpose is to support independent living for senior citizens and adults with disabilities by offering an affordable, volunteer-based grocery shopping and delivery service. This service ensures that homebound individuals can maintain their autonomy, increase their social connections, and access additional resources that aid in aging in place. By providing this personal service, Store To Door also serves as a resource for identifying frail elderly individuals who may require additional social assistance. The organization's vision is to create a Portland community where all seniors and individuals with disabilities can live with dignity, nourishment, and inclusion. With a team of 29 dedicated employees, Store To Door makes a significant impact on the lives of those in need.

What are the reviews and ratings of this charity?

Charity Navigator Rating: 88% (Three-Star out of Four Stars)

Store To Door has received a solid rating of 88%, reflecting a strong performance in areas such as impact measurement and leadership adaptability. With an impressive score of 100 in leadership adaptability and a high impact measurement score of 95, the organization demonstrates its commitment to effectively serving its community. The accountability and finance score of 81 suggests a well-managed operation, with 100% of board members being independent, reinforcing transparency and good governance.

User feedback highlights a mix of experiences. Positive reviews from volunteers emphasize the organization's dedication to helping seniors maintain their independence by providing reliable grocery delivery services. Many appreciate the volunteers' attention to detail and commitment, ensuring that the needs of the clients are consistently met.

However, there are notable concerns regarding some delivery drivers, with reports of theft and inadequate deliveries from certain individuals. This raises issues about accountability at the operational level, prompting the need for Store To Door to address these incidents to maintain trust and integrity in their service. Overall, while the organization performs well in many areas, addressing these reported issues is crucial for sustaining its positive reputation.

Is Store To Door legitimate?

Store To Door is a legitimate nonprofit organization registered as a 501(c)(3) entity. Store To Door submitted a form 990, which is a tax form used by tax-exempt organizations in the U.S., indicating its operational transparency and adherence to regulatory requirements. Donations to this organization are tax deductible.

Impact




July, 2024

Store To Door's impact is profound in the Portland area, where it supports independent living for seniors and adults with disabilities by providing a crucial grocery shopping and delivery service. This service not only helps individuals who have difficulty shopping on their own due to age or disability but also addresses social isolation by having volunteer drivers interact personally with clients. By nourishing, including, and allowing individuals to age with dignity in a setting of their own choice, Store To Door is enriching the lives of those it serves and contributing to a more inclusive and supportive community.
